MTV Video Music Awards (acrônimo: VMA ou VMAs) é uma premiação musical apresentada pelo canal MTV, tendo sido criada em 1984, de forma em enaltecer os melhores videoclipes do ano. Originalmente concebidos como uma alternativa irreverente aos Grammy Awards , o MTV Video Music Awards é atualmente um respeitado evento de entrega de prêmios da música mais popular nos EUA.

MTV Video Music Awards. · 1997 →. The 1996 MTV Video Music Awards aired live on September 4, 1996, honoring the best music videos from June 16, 1995, to June 14, 1996. The show was hosted by Dennis Miller at Radio City Music Hall in New York City . The show centered on The Smashing Pumpkins, who led the pack that night with nine nominations.
